    Awwwwww, I see RED has found my youtube videos. That 1st one I tried putting together and it didn't load well on Youtube.... Here is another video alittle better...
    http://www.hammockforums.net/forum/v...ls&videoid=177

    Hulk, the fabric is 1.1 sil and weighs 1lb 14oz minus cord & stakes. I mainly use the shelter as a base camp when hunting and cold. Used many many times and never had an issue. The stove is a small TI box that weighs 2lbs 9oz. Doug from TI Goat does a great job.

    Turk has some videos of the large TI stove.
